Types of Mental Health Providers in College City, CA
A mental health disorder can express itself in various ways, (negative or irrational thoughts, physical ailments, problematic behaviors) and the intensity can range from mild to severe. For that reason, there are different care providers who can provide various types of treatment. Let’s consider each option:
Psychologists in College City
Psychologists are trained to conduct psychological evaluations and provide diagnoses. They’re highly adept at helping individuals understand and cope with their feelings and thoughts, and usually do so through talk therapy in an individual or group setting. The majority of treatment zeros in on identifying and changing destructive and otherwise unhealthy behaviors.
Psychiatrists in College City
Psychiatrists are medical doctors (M.D) who have received psychiatric training. The main difference between psychologists and psychiatrists is that psychiatrists are able to prescribe medications. As such, psychiatrists are the type of mental health professionals sought after to help address chronic disorders or serious mental illness (SMI), which typically require medical treatment. While they are trained and qualified to conduct psychotherapy (talk therapy), some psychiatrists choose not to.
Therapists, Counselors & Clinicians in College City
Each of these terms are interchangeable and are used to describe mental health care professionals with a masters-level education in fields such as psychology, marriage and family therapy, or other specialties. They function more like psychologists than psychiatrists, being treatment-focused often with an emphasis on modifying behavior. More often than not, talk therapy is the primary mode of treatment offered.
Paying for College City Mental Health Services
In reference to paying for mental health rehab, various people will have a few different options depending on financial circumstances. As mentioned previously, reaching out to your insurance provider is wise. They will likely even be able to provide recommendations for in-network mental health rehabs. Option 2 is out-of-pocket payment. This is a typical option for people who select a mental health rehab not covered by their insurance, or in the absence of healthcare coverage. Option 3 is receiving treatment at a state-funded mental health facility. This may be the best option for individuals who are uninsured or have limited financial resources.
